> On 4/11/08, Milan Křápek <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> > Thanks for quick response. But I am not sure, that this what I want. I
> think it will need a little bit more description.
> >
> > As I said I have table where I listed some objects from database. I have
> there link which creates new modal window. But I do not give any model to
> this modal window. In this modal window there is a form which I fill and with
> the filled parameters I create a new object that I store to database. Than I
> close the modal window.
> >
> > So in the modal window object I have not any model (ListView or
> DataTable) that can be refreshed. So I need to refresh the whole parent page.
> >
> > On wiki I found some example:
> >
> > modalWindow.setWindowClosedCallback(new WindowClosedCallback(){
> > private static final long serialVersionUID = 1L;
> >
> > @Override
> > public void onClose(AjaxRequestTarget target){
> > target.addComponent(parentPage);
> > }
> > });
> >
> > But I dont know how to create the parentPage object and what is the type
> of it. I tried to create new page just something like
> >
> > parentPage = new Mypage();
> >
> > but of course this does not work. Than I try this
> >
> > target.addComponent(new WebMarkupContainer("myPage", new Model(new
> MyPage())));
> >
> > this does not wokrs too. Please any other idea how to reload the WHOLE
> page.
